Transaction 14470fee51b314ba622328d927737cae8e64ae5905c3934bbc18942c7319070a

1 Input
2 Outputs
  • 14470fee51b314ba622328d927737cae8e64ae5905c3934bbc18942c7319070a:0
  • value  105000000
    address  3QrP4erKqHa86nMKx2t6Yin7KSxtMHarAs
  • 14470fee51b314ba622328d927737cae8e64ae5905c3934bbc18942c7319070a:1
  • value  26946680
    address  3CYwXpYZsks2GDUGKHd3wRmpExQFr3C2Ao